All commands start with `omarchy-`. Prefixes indicate purpose:
- `cmd-` - check if commands exist, misc utility commands
- `capture-` - screenshots, screen recordings, and other capture tools
- `pkg-` - package management helpers
- `hw-` - hardware detection (return exit codes for use in conditionals)
- `refresh-` - copy default config to user's `~/.config/`

# omarchy:summary=Set the Omarchy channel, which dictates what git branch and package repository is used.
# omarchy:args=<stable|rc|edge|dev>
# omarchy:requires-sudo=true
# Set the Omarchy channel, which dictates what git branch and package repository is used.
#
# Stable uses the master branch, which only sees updates on official releases, and
# the stable package repository, which typically lags the edge by a month to ensure
# better compatibility.
#
# Edge tracks the latest package repository, but still relies on the master branch,
# so new packages which require config changes may cause conflicts or errors.
#
# Dev tracks the active development dev branch, which may include partial or broken updates,
# as well as the latest package repository. This should only be used by Omarchy developers
# and people with a lot of experience managing Linux systems.
